AV system should find the right control signals to move a vehicle in the right direction. There are a lot of problems making the task complex. First of all relation between control signals and vehicle movement is not linear. A second one, there are a lot of possible trajectories with different qualities. Next, there are other agents and objects on the road. Some of them have unpredictable behavior. And some unexpected events can radically change vehicle trajectory: some stone under a wheel, wet surface, and even wind.

There are a lot of algorithms to solve the problem. One of them is called Model Predictive Path Integral Control (MPPI). Initially, it was developed to control AutoRally vehicles model with one-fifth scale. Look at the video. I especially make the link on the moment where you can see problems: inertion, unexpected road grip, and stones.

Without details algorithm is simple. Let's assume that at each moment we have some control sequence for the next few seconds. Initially, it can be a "do nothing" sequence. At each step of the algorithm, we create a few thousand new control sequences. Then each sequence is converted to trajectory using a vehicle dynamic model (based on a neural network). Each trajectory is evaluated by multiple parameters, e.g. drive time, sharpness, obstacle crossing, etc. Finally, the best trajectory is selected and a first control step from it is executed.

By repeating the algorithm at 40Hz you can drive the car as shown in the video. Sampled trajectories are shown as fans ahead of the car.

A week ago Sber showed the prototype of a self-driving bus called Flip. The news was on heavy rotation so I skipped it. But yesterday the relay race of strange buses was continued by Aurrigo startup in GB.

The electric vehicle can travel up to 32km/h and have a range of 161km. A trial of three vehicles will start in June. They will operate on public roads between Madingley park and ride, West Cambridge campus. The bus is equipped with a safety driver.

Localization is one of the most important AV task. Traditional ways are GNSS+RTK, inertial tracking, odometry, and lidar-based localization. The MIT research lab has proposed new all-weather way. They achieve centimetre accuracy by detecting underground objects using special geo-radar (stones, caves, cables, tubes etc.).

Pony.ai is eighth company got permission for testing AV in the California. Unlike other startups they shows test in bad weather conditions and heavy road traffic. It is nice china startup with 400M investment from Toyota.
